John Crome, 1768-1821 Scroll down for information. Click here to return to the list. |  | Hoveton St. Peter, Norfolk
Original softground etching with touches of pure etching, in black ink. c.1812. Signed with initials in the plate. From the first edition of 60 impressions. As completed by Crome in c.1812, and with no rework. Issued by the artist's widow, 1834. Almost no impressions dating from 1812 are
known.
Ref: Theobald - John Crome no 30,only state, without rework.
Extremely fine tonal impression. On off white laid india (chine appliqué) with a pale cream toned wove backing sheet, as printed. Excellent condition; the faintest sign of an old mount mark. Very good margins. Sheet: 11 x 15 ins. Plate: 6 1/2 x 9 3/8ins (165x239mm)
